Career path

Role Key Responsibilities
Logistics Safety Manager Develop and implement safety regulations for third-party logistics operations.
Compliance Specialist Ensure adherence to safety regulations and standards set by regulatory bodies.
Transportation Safety Coordinator Monitor and enforce safety protocols for transportation activities in third-party logistics.
Warehouse Safety Supervisor Oversee safety measures and procedures in warehouse operations.
Risk Management Analyst Analyze potential risks and develop strategies to mitigate them in third-party logistics.
Quality Assurance Inspector Conduct inspections to ensure compliance with safety regulations and quality standards.
Health and Safety Officer Promote a culture of safety and wellness in the workplace.
